Senior League baseball bats have certain factors to consider.

Considering what you like, there are many options. They are made for players in all ranges from little league to professional. They can be made of woods or metal and this may be determined by your league. Try bats in different sizes and lengths.They vary and have to be within certain guidelines, depending on the league.

Some batters feel they can get a faster swing and harder hit with lighter bats. Others feel that a heavier bat will send the ball further. It really boils down to what ever gives you the best and most consistent swing that makes good contact with the ball. The real answer will be in the accuracy and distance achieved on each swing. If the bat feels right and you are getting results, that is all we need to know.

Remember to take your time and enjoy finding that LUCKY bat.The wrong one can mess up a good hitter. In fact, when choosing, you should give it the real test by actually hitting some balls. This allows the batter to get a true feel for the grip, length, weight,etc. See which ones feel natural and especially ones that you get good hits with.

If you can, “borrow” a bat that seems to work well for you. Continue to use it in practice and games to see if it is really working for you. When you have found what really works for you, go ahead and buy your very own bat. Nothing beats having your own personal bat. It gives you that edge of familiarity and confidence.
